首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

刚开始尝试导入SQL转储以便在python中使用的SQL新手,总是收到"missing database“和"missing column”错误

对于刚开始尝试导入SQL转储以便在Python中使用的SQL新手,收到"missing database"和"missing column"错误的问题,可能是由于以下原因导致的:

  1. "missing database"错误:这通常意味着你尝试连接或查询的数据库不存在。你需要确保你已经正确地创建了数据库,并且在连接数据库时使用了正确的数据库名称。如果你使用的是关系型数据库,比如MySQL,可以使用以下步骤来解决该问题:
    • 确保你已经安装并正确配置了数据库服务器。
    • 使用数据库管理工具(如phpMyAdmin)或命令行工具(如MySQL命令行客户端)创建一个新的数据库。
    • 在Python代码中,使用正确的数据库连接字符串或配置信息连接到数据库。
  • "missing column"错误:这通常意味着你尝试查询的表中缺少了某个列。你需要确保你的表结构与你的查询语句相匹配。如果你使用的是关系型数据库,可以使用以下步骤来解决该问题:
    • 确保你已经正确地创建了表,并且表中包含了你尝试查询的列。
    • 检查你的查询语句,确保你引用的列名与表中的列名一致。
    • 如果你在查询中使用了表的别名,请确保别名与表的实际名称一致。

在解决这些错误之前,你需要对SQL和数据库的基本概念有一定的了解。SQL(Structured Query Language)是一种用于管理关系型数据库的语言,它可以用于创建、查询、更新和删除数据库中的数据。数据库是一个用于存储和管理数据的系统,它可以提供高效的数据访问和管理功能。

对于SQL新手,我建议你可以参考腾讯云的云数据库MySQL产品。云数据库MySQL是腾讯云提供的一种高性能、可扩展的关系型数据库服务,它提供了简单易用的管理界面和强大的性能优化功能,可以帮助你更轻松地管理和使用MySQL数据库。

腾讯云云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b

总结起来,解决"missing database"和"missing column"错误的关键是确保数据库和表的存在,并且与你的代码和查询语句相匹配。另外,建议你可以参考腾讯云的云数据库MySQL产品来简化数据库管理和使用的过程。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L基础教程:数据导入导出

简介 学会数据库导入导出非常重要,为什么呢?向下看。首先您可以把数据进行备份还原,以便在紧急情况下恢复数据库旧副本。您还可以把数据迁移到新服务器或开发环境。...在MySQLMariaDB数据库导入导出非常简单。本教程将介绍如何导出数据库以及如何从MySQLMariaDB中导入数据库。...准备 要导入/或导出MySQL或MariaDB数据库,您需要MySQL或MariaDB服务器,您可以使用腾讯云免费开发者实验室来进行试验。或购买腾讯云数据库服务。...在普通命令行使用以下命令导入SQL文件: mysql -u username -p new_database < data-dump.sql username 是您数据库用户名 database_name...可以通过选择新数据库USE new_database然后使用SHOW TABLES; 或类似命令来查看数据库是完整。 结论 您现在知道如何从MySQL数据库创建数据库以及如何再次导入它们。

1.7K60

最近几个技术问题总结答疑(五)(r9笔记第9天)

最近收到了几个朋友提问,我简单总结了一下。 问题1: 首先是有个朋友问到,单引号,双引号在有些场合通用,有些场合会提示错误。 我做了一个简单测试,当然只是一个相对片面的解读,能够说明问题即可。...* ERROR at line 1: ORA-00922: missing or invalid option SQL> alter user sys identified by "asdfasga!...可以看到测试情况,其实也可以间接说明双引号在含有特殊字符场景是必须使用,而对于单引号,只是单纯标示一个字符串,为什么第一个语句执行失败,因为数据库把第一个单引号当做了密码一部分,所以检查失败。...问题2: 怎么从arch拿到DBID? 这个问题看起来还是很有意思,看起来不是常规思路。我们来简单测试一下。 把归档文件拷贝到备库,日志信息。...=2097152=0x200000 File Number=20, Blksiz=512, File Type=2 LOG 不局限于备库,我们可以把归档拷贝到另外一个数据库目录下,再次

62850

玩转SQLite2:SQLite命令行基本操作

本篇介绍SQLite命令行基本操作 1 SQLite 点命令 SQLite 点命令,是一些点为开头命令: 完整点指令如下: .archive ...... SQL 文本格式数据库 .echo on|off 开启或关闭 echo 命令 .eqp on|off|full|......显示帮助 .import FILE TABLE 导入来自 FILE 文件数据到 TABLE 表 .imposter INDEX TABLE Create imposter table...Set minimum column widths for columnar output 例如,使用.show指令可以查看当前各种设置: 2 SQLite 创建数据库 使用sqlite3 命令来创建数据库有两种方式...open test2.db创建test2数据库 2.3 将数据库导出到文件 使用 .dump 点命令导出数据库到文本文件 sqlite3 test1.db .dump > test1.sql 也可以从生成

77420

整理系列文章:Oracle DBA 必备技能学习索引

对于 Oracle DBA,我们整理了以下学习线索,供大家参考: Oracle DBA 必备核心技能: Oracle DBA核心技能:数据库跟踪分析方法之SQL_TRACEDBMS_SYSTEM...通过10046解决数据库RAC集群不能启动案例 Oracle DBA核心技能:System State分析之ROW CACHE ENQUEUE问题定位 Oracle DBA核心技能:使用 errorstack...进行错误跟踪诊断 Oracle DBA核心技能:AWR数据导出导入转移 Oracle DBA核心技能:AWR 深度解读 Redo Nowait指标的算法诊断 Oracle DBA核心技能:举一反三触类旁通.../ TABLE 带来敏捷便利 文档推荐: Oracle数据库跟踪分析方法 这是WORD格式完整版本,介绍了Oracle数据库至关重要跟踪诊断方法案例解析。...Oracle数据库 MISSING 名称数据文件是如何出现? Oracle 12.2 使用 8 字节存储SCN带来影响?

89200

米斯特白帽培训讲义(v2)漏洞篇 SQL 注入

关于数据库环境我想说一下,不同数据库使用不同配置 SQL 方言,一个数据库上有用方法不一定能用在另一个数据库上。但是,目前 70% 网站都使用 MySQL,所以这篇讲义只会涉及 MySQL。...判断列数量 我们下一步需要判断查询结果列数量,以便之后使用union语句。我们构造: id=1 order by ? 其中问号处替换为从 1 开始数字,一个一个尝试它们。...例如我这里,先尝试 1,没有报错: ? 尝试 2 也没有报错,然后尝试 3 时候: ? 出现了错误,说明列数是 2。...,1 我们把问号替换为 0 1,就得到了所有的数据。 ? 手工注入:基于布尔值 在一些情况下,页面上是没有回显。也就是说,不显示任何数据库信息。我们只能根据输出判断是否成功、失败、或者错误。...附录 The SQL Injection Knowledge Base 新手指南:DVWA-1.9全级别教程之SQL Injection 新手指南:DVWA-1.9全级别教程之SQL Injection

2.3K70

Soda Core:最简单开源数据可靠性工具

Soda Core是一个免费开源命令行工具。它利用用户定义输入来准备 SQL 查询,对数据源数据集运行检查,查找无效、丢失或意外数据。...4、Soda Scan Soda Scan 执行您在检查 YAML 文件定义检查,并返回每个检查结果:通过、失败或错误。(您可以通过设置警报配置来配置检查发出警告而不是失败。)...在这些检查,我们可以使用 Soda 辅助功能,甚至可以编写 SQL 查询来定义我们需求。...在现实生活,不可能每次都在终端上手动运行检查。在这方面,我们需要使用 Python 编程方式运行我们检查。 Soda Python 库支持编程检查,我们不需要一直使用 CLI。...下面我创建了一个 Python 脚本来读取配置并检查文件并执行它们。为了得到错误,我将使用 freshness.yml 文件。

65230

SQL Server使用缺失索引建议优化非聚集索引

建议使用包含列,然而,当包含列数量过大时,SQL Server 不会对所得索引大小进行成本效益分析。 缺失索引请求可能会在查询对同一表列提供类似的索引变体。 查看索引建议并尽可能合并非常重要。...自动索引优化使用机器学习通过 AI 从 Azure SQL 数据库所有数据库横向学习,并动态改进其优化操作。 自动索引优化包括一个验证过程,确保工作负载性能通过创建索引能得到显著改善。...sys.dm_db_missing_index_details (Transact-SQL) 返回有关缺失索引详细信息,例如它返回缺少索引名称标识符,以及构成缺失索引列类型。...使用查询存储保留缺失索引 DMV 缺失索引建议会因实例重启、故障转移将数据库设置为脱机等事件而清除。 此外,当表元数据发生更改时,有关此表所有缺失索引信息都将从这些动态管理对象删除。...创建索引时,请考虑使用联机索引操作(如果可用)。 虽然索引在某些情况下可以显着提高查询性能,但索引也有开销管理成本。 请查看常规索引设计指南,帮助在创建索引之前评估索引好处。

13810

MySQL 8.0.14版本新功能详解

用侧接指定派生表只能出现在FROM子句中,要么出现在逗号分隔表列表,要么出现在联接规范(联接、内联接、交叉联接、左[外]联接或右[外]联接)。...修改内容: 1.X Plugin现在在其错误处理类包含5位SQLSTATE错误代码。以前,SQL错误SQLSTATE错误代码返回给客户机,但是只公开特定于mysql错误编号。...(错误# 28735058) 2.在查询文档集合时,如果在SQL查询中将布尔值用作占位符参数,则会返回意外结果。现在为布尔值添加了一个新翻译专门化,以便在这种情况下正确处理它们。...(错误# 28227037) 3.在返回数据之前,X协议现在总是将检索到数据转换为utf8mb4字符集(使用utf8mb4_general_ci排序规则)。...(Bug #90337, Bug #27828236) 从MySQL 5.7服务器导入到运行MySQL 8.0服务器时,当使用8.0服务器不支持SQL模式时,ER_WRONG_VALUE_FOR_VAR

1.6K20

一次Oracle导入dmp文件日志记录

要了一个dmp文件想导入数据库,也不知道对端导出格式、数据库版本、导出方式,只是提供了一份导出日志导出dmp文件,盲人摸象似的尝试一下如何导入吧,很久不用Oracle语法都是百度来,先尝试imp,再尝试..., OLAP, Data Mining and Real Application Testing options ORA-39001: 参数值无效 ORA-39000: 文件说明错误 ORA-31640...: 无法打开要读取文件 "c:\DAMS_20190803.dmp" ORA-27041: 无法打开文件 OSD-04002: ???????...AAAA" 创建失败, 出现错误: ORA-01918: 用户 'DAMS' 不存在 失败 sql 为: CREATE TABLE "DAMS"."...SYS_IMPORT_FULL_01" 已经完成, 但是有 8 个错误 (于 12:50:19 完成) --变更 再次导入,少了DAMS用户对象 --在数据库创建DAMS用户 C:\Users\baoqi

1.2K20

大数据ETL实践探索(7)---- 使用python 进行oracle 全库数据描述性及探索性逆向分析

下面就以Oracle 为例,使用python 进行全库数据描述性及探索性逆向分析。...Oracle Database and conforms to the Python database API specification....# -- 3.创建用户并指定表空间 -- 刚开始用户名为 ,提示错误ORA-65096:公用用户名或角色名无效,网上查资料,说是取名前缀必须为c##, --所以用户名也变成了c##test --首次创建用户时提示...参照第6小节数据导入导出,进行原始数据导入导出。...链接Oracle 全库数据采样 本节主要用到了上面的操作类,使用oracle user_tables 获取数据所有表名称,之后按照采样设置进行链接及采样,并根据采样数据计算数据缺失率,以求初步了解数据业务紧密关联

75820

12c RMAN新特性之Recover Table

该表被恢复到一个辅助实例,并且可以选择: 使用 REMAP 选项将恢复导入新表或分区 仅在恢复创建 expdp dump 文件,以便在其他时间进行导入 先决条件 目标数据库必须处于读写模式。...(4) 创建包含恢复表或表分区数据泵导出文件。您可以指定用于存储恢复表或表分区元数据数据泵导出文件名称位置。...(5) (可选)将 Data Pump 导出文件导入到目标实例。您可以选择不将包含恢复表或表分区导出文件导入目标数据库。...如果不将导出文件作为恢复过程一部分导入,则必须稍后使用“数据泵导入”实用程序手动导入它。 注:如果在导入操作期间发生错误,RMAN 不会在表恢复结束时删除导出文件。...这使您能够手动导入文件。 (6) (可选)重命名目标数据库已恢复表或表分区。您还可以将恢复对象导入到与最初存在表空间或模式不同表空间或模式

43520

LocalCatalog详解之Coordinator处理流程

FE端相关类介绍 当c节点接收到client发来SQL请求之后,会通过JNI来调用FE端代码,进行SQL解析,相关操作API入口位于JniFrontend.java,具体执行处理逻辑位于Frontend.java...Map每一条记录都代表database一个表,这里tpch库为例,对应数据如下所示: 初次获取到这些元数据信息之后,就会在CatalogdMetaProvider本地缓存中保存下来...由此我们可以知道,在LocalCatalog模式下,SQL涉及到表,都不会是missing table(普通Catalog模式下处理逻辑有所不同,如果是第一次访问表,则会被当作missing tables...我们在上一章节中提到,获取missing table时候,会将SQL涉及到表进行load操作。...目前,Impala最新4.0版本,对于LocalCatalog模式支持也已经比较成熟,感兴趣读者可以尝试一下。此外,本文是笔者基于社区4.0.0代码分析而来,如有错误,欢迎批评指正。

22720

关于asp.net与winform导出excel代码

那么把DataSet数据导出,也就是把DataSet各行信息,ms-excel格式Response到http流,这样就OK了。...,missing,missing);     xlApp.Quit();    } 三、附注: 虽然都是实现导出 execl功能,但在asp.netwinform程序,实现代码是各不相同...在asp.net,是在服务器端读取数据,在服务器端把数据 ms-execl格式,Response输出到浏览器(客户端);而在winform,是把数据读到客户端(因为winform运行端就是客户...//输出为Table,能够最大限度减少字段数据对生成文件格式影响,在这里我没有处理数据中含有HTML标签情况 在页面后台中,这样使用就可以了:     protected void lbtnToExcel_Click...dll时 注意其版本,具体各个版本可以到我资源下载地址http://download.csdn.net/detail/haiziguo/4469170 本次用到dataset导入到excel代码

5.5K10
领券